Gov’t Kicks off Construction of 28 Farm Access Roads at Shs32bn

Nyabitusi, KAMWENGE – The Minister of Agriculture, Animal Industry and Fisheries, Hon. Frank Kagyigyi Tumwebaze, has flagged off the construction of 4 of 29 farm access roads under the Agriculture Cluster Development Project in Kamwenge District.

The 4 farm access roads which will cost at Shs2.3bn are part of the 29 farm access roads that will be constructed across the country at a cost of Shs32bn.

In partnership with the World Bank, the Government of Uganda has earmarked 29 road chokes for construction to ease access to markets from high production centers to boost commercial agriculture for the smallholder farmers.

This exercise is being implemented under the Ministry’s Agriculture Cluster Development Project funded by the World Bank over a period of 6 years and implemented in 57 districts of Uganda.

Speaking at the ground-breaking ceremony, Hon. Tumwebaze said that the 37.6KM of farm access roads that would be rehabilitated in Kamwenge District would cost Shs2,301,237,615/= only.

The roads are in Kamwenge (17.6km), Bwizi/Biguli (10km), Bwizi/Nkoma (5km) and Bihanga (5km) sub-counties

“These road chokes are government’s intervention to ensure that our farmers are not farming for the stomach and can be able to engage in trade and boost their household incomes as we have been saying under the Parish Development Model recently rolled out by the Government,” Hon. Tumwebaze said.

The 4 farm access roads are a part of the total of 29 farm access roads that will be constructed in 57 districts of Uganda where the Agriculture Cluster Development Project is currently hosted. These road chokes will cost a total of Shs32.1bn.

The District LCV Chairman, Mr Joseph Karungi, extended his gratitude to the Government of Uganda through Ministry of Agriculture, Animal Industry and Fisheries for the increased involvement of their stakeholders in the implementation of Government programs.

“The Contractor who has been introduced to us, Tamsack Development Link Uganda Ltd, is managed by one of our own and we can follow up for efficiency in the construction and completion of the road works,” Mr Karungi said.
